| Summary: | Provides an overview of the geography, history, government, people, arts, foods, and other aspects of life in the Czech Republic. Once part of communist Czechoslovakia, the land that is now the Czech Republic has endured years of foreign occupation and cultural oppression. Today, Czech culture has made an energetic comeback, with Czech music, literature, drama, and traditional arts earning worldwide acclaim and recognition. From handmade wooden puppets to beautiful Bohemian crystal, from the medieval town of Cesky Krumlov to the modern capital of Prague, and from the festive polka to moving symphonies, this book investigates the traditions behind one of the world's youngest countries and celebrates the spirit of freedom that inspires its people today
